Grocery Costs in Helenville
Grocery prices in Helenville are generally affordable, making it easier for residents to maintain a balanced diet without breaking the bank. Understanding local prices can help you plan your budget effectively.
Average Grocery Prices
- Milk (gallon): Approximately $3.50.
- Bread (loaf): Around $2.50.
- Eggs (dozen): About $2.00.
- Fresh produce: Prices vary, but expect $1-$3 per pound for fruits and vegetables.
Dining Out Costs
- Fast food meal: Around $8-$12 per person.
- Casual dining: Expect to pay $15-$30 for a meal at a family-friendly restaurant.
- Special occasions: Fine dining can range from $25-$50 per person.
